| i took it for about a year, its a pretty harmless drug. It helped with my pain and my sleep. But i had to abruptly get off of it for some lab test that i had to do. After it wore off i felt soo much anxiety and nervousness. I did some reading about it, you have to stop taking it gradually or you can get major anxiety, sleeplessness, or even seziures. |
